FWIW, i recommend moving the OpenAPI spec to a new directory at commerce-extensibility/static/rest/extensibility.yaml or some variation of that. The important thing is to put it in a static/ directory.
That way, you can reference the path to the spec in the redocly block as such:
<RedoclyAPIBlock src='/commerce/extensibility/rest/extensibility.yaml' />
See AdobeDocs/commerce-services#284 for an example.
I think that this will make it easier to validate changes that you make to the spec now and in the future when you deploy to stage. If you use the raw github URL, I think you'll have to update the spec AND update the raw URL in the redocly block, which doesn't seem ideal.
